eternal line
Word 2000
I recently added a line to a Word document. I put in 2030 dashes that turned to a solid line when I hit ENTER. Now I am unable to delete the line. Whatever I do fails. How do I get rid of the line? |

eternal line
It's probably a paragraph border. Put your cursor in the paragraph above it,
go to Format - Borders and Shading. -- JoAnn Paules MVP Microsoft [Publisher] Tech Editor for "Microsoft Publisher 2007 For Dummies" "j lunis" wrote in message ...
